The 1922 NFL season was the third regular season of what was now called the National Football League (NFL); the league changed its name from American Professional Football Association (APFA) on June 24, 1922.

A total of 75 games were played by the 18 teams of the league, with a claimed total attendance in excess of 400,000. The league championship was won by the Canton Bulldogs, the first of two back-to back titles.
